The GRE Score Reporting System is a digital platform designed to accurately compile, manage, and disseminate GRE test scores for individual candidates. It facilitates the efficient transfer of scores to designated institutions, provides detailed score reports, and helps educational institutions evaluate applicants effectively. The system aims to streamline the process, ensure data security, and improve the overall experience for both test-takers and evaluators.

Key Features

  • Secure electronic score transmission to authorized institutions
  • Detailed score reports with scaled scores and percentiles
  • User account management for test-takers
  • Integration with educational institution databases
  • Real-time score access and tracking
  • Automated reporting and notifications
  • Data privacy and security compliance
